HEART began in 2016 when a group of social workers saw how many people were falling through the cracks in behavioral health care. They noticed how confusing and disconnected the system felt for the people who needed it most. Instead of accepting it, they decided to build a place where care actually connects.
Since then, HEART has continued to grow, expanding programs, opening access to more communities, and working with local agencies, leaders, and providers to help anyone seeking support feel guided, not lost.
Our mission has not changed. No one should be left behind when it comes to mental health or recovery.

Every staff member at HEART is trained in trauma-informed care. We use the principles of safety, trust, transparency, and collaboration through all phases of treatment. Our clinic follows a trauma-informed design that supports privacy and comfort, helping clients feel at ease from the moment they walk in.
Our programming includes trauma-centered approaches such as Seeking Safety for co-occurring PTSD and substance use, as well as EMDR in individual therapy sessions.

HEART is licensed by the State of Michigan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s to provide outpatient substance use services. Since 2016, we have delivered both mental health and addiction recovery care.
Our programming includes ASAM level 2.1 Intensive Outpatient, Sub-Acute Ambulatory Withdrawal Management with ASAM-approved physicians, and a full range of mental health services.
Our leadership team brings years of direct service experience across Michigan’s regional health systems. Our organization maintains relationships with major third-party payors and accreditation bodies, including CARF and the Joint Commission.
